What are the common symptoms of worn rear stabilizer links on a Mercedes-Benz GLS X167?
Worn rear stabilizer links on a Mercedes-Benz GLS X167 can cause or contribute to several noticeable suspension symptoms, with knocking, clunking, tapping or rattling noises from the rear suspension being among the most common reasons to inspect these components. The rear sway bar links work whenever the suspension moves, so their joints repeatedly articulate during normal everyday driving. When the Mercedes-Benz GLS X167 travels over potholes, speed breakers, broken roads, road joints or uneven surfaces, each rear wheel responds to changes in the road and the stabilizer links move as part of the suspension system. During cornering, the sway links also experience changing mechanical loads because suspension movement can differ between the left and right sides of the vehicle. Over thousands of kilometres, repeated suspension movement, road vibration and impacts can gradually create mechanical wear inside the joints. Once excessive clearance develops, a worn anti roll link rod may move slightly whenever the suspension changes position, direction or load. This unwanted movement can create a noticeable knocking or clunking sound from the rear suspension. Smaller amounts of joint wear may produce lighter tapping or rattling noises. These sounds can become particularly noticeable when the GLS is driven slowly over rough roads, small potholes or speed breakers because individual suspension movements are easier to hear. In some cases, the rear suspension may simply sound less solid or refined than it previously did. However, a knocking or rattling sound does not automatically mean that the stabiliser sway links are defective. The Mercedes-Benz GLS X167 rear suspension contains several other components capable of producing similar symptoms. Rear anti-roll bar bushes, suspension arms, suspension bushes, dampers, mountings and related hardware should also be inspected. A professional technician should physically check both rear stabilizer links for excessive joint movement, damaged protective components, loose mounting points, corrosion, deterioration or other signs of wear. If one link is badly worn, the corresponding component on the opposite side should also be inspected because both generally experience similar overall mileage and road conditions. This does not mean that both links must automatically be replaced whenever only one component has developed a problem, but replacing them together can be practical when both show comparable wear. Correct diagnosis is important because installing new stabilizer links cannot repair a suspension noise caused by another defective component. How long do rear stabilizer link rods normally last on a Mercedes-Benz GLS X167?
There is no single fixed mileage, number of years or universal replacement interval for the rear stabilizer link rods on every Mercedes-Benz GLS X167 because their actual service life depends on road quality, total vehicle mileage, driving conditions, driving style, suspension condition, environmental exposure, previous suspension repairs and the amount of impact experienced during normal use. Rear stabilizer links should therefore generally be treated as condition-based suspension components rather than parts that automatically require replacement after one predetermined number of kilometres. A Mercedes-Benz GLS X167 mainly driven on smooth highways may place less impact stress on its rear sway bar links than another GLS regularly driven over potholes, broken city roads, uneven surfaces and large speed breakers. Every time the rear wheels move upward or downward, the sway links articulate as part of the stabilizer system. During cornering, the anti roll link rods also experience changing mechanical loads because suspension movement on one side of the vehicle can differ from movement on the opposite side. This means the joints repeatedly move whenever the vehicle is being driven. Over thousands of kilometres, road vibration, repeated suspension articulation, pothole impacts and changing loads can gradually create mechanical wear. Dirt, moisture and deterioration around protective joint components can also influence long-term service life. Driving conditions can make a considerable difference because repeated impacts from poor roads can place additional stress on suspension components. This is why two Mercedes-Benz GLS X167 vehicles with exactly the same mileage can have very different rear stabilizer-link conditions. One vehicle may still have links in acceptable mechanical condition while another may already have developed excessive joint clearance. For this reason, mileage alone should not determine whether replacement is necessary. Physical inspection provides a much better indication of component condition. Common reasons for inspecting the rear links include knocking, clunking, tapping or rattling sounds from the rear suspension, particularly when driving slowly over potholes, rough roads or speed breakers. A technician should physically check both stabiliser sway links for excessive joint movement, damaged protective components, loose mounting points, corrosion, deterioration or physical damage. If one component has significant wear, the opposite-side link should also be inspected because both generally experience similar overall mileage. When both components show comparable deterioration, replacing them together can be practical. The surrounding suspension should also be inspected because rear anti-roll bar bushes, suspension arms, suspension bushes, dampers, mountings and related components can independently create similar noises. Therefore, there is no correct universal statement that the GLS X167 rear stabilizer links must be replaced at a particular mileage. Actual mechanical condition should determine replacement. Can replacing worn rear stabilizer links improve the handling and stability of a Mercedes-Benz GLS X167?
Replacing genuinely worn rear stabilizer links can help restore normal suspension response and handling consistency in a Mercedes-Benz GLS X167 when the existing components have developed excessive joint clearance, mechanical deterioration or physical damage, but standard replacement stabilizer links should not be described as a performance upgrade because their main purpose is to restore the mechanical connection required by the original suspension system. The rear anti-roll bar forms part of the GLS X167 chassis system, while the rear sway bar links connect the bar with the relevant suspension components. During normal straight-line driving, the rear suspension continuously responds to changes in the road surface. When the vehicle enters a corner, vehicle weight naturally transfers and the suspension on one side can move differently from the suspension on the opposite side. The anti-roll bar works as part of the suspension system to help manage excessive body movement, while the sway links provide the mechanical connection required for the stabilizer system to operate. When the joints inside the links remain in good mechanical condition, they maintain this connection while allowing the necessary suspension articulation. After extended use, however, repeated suspension movement, road vibration, pothole impacts and changing mechanical loads can gradually create unwanted clearance inside the joints. When an anti roll link rod becomes badly worn, this excessive movement can reduce the consistency of the mechanical connection between the suspension and stabilizer system. Worn links may also contribute to knocking, clunking, tapping or rattling noises from the rear suspension. When proper inspection confirms that the stabiliser sway links are genuinely worn, replacing them removes the unwanted movement caused specifically by those components. As a result, the rear suspension may feel more solid, controlled or consistent compared with how it felt with badly worn links. This should be understood as restoring lost suspension function rather than increasing the Mercedes-Benz GLS X167's handling capability beyond its original specification. If the existing stabilizer links remain in good mechanical condition, simply installing another standard replacement set should not create a major handling improvement. Overall stability depends on the complete chassis system, including suspension arms, bushes, dampers, springs or applicable air-suspension components, tyres, tyre pressures, wheels, steering components and wheel alignment. If the GLS feels unstable, loose or unusual during cornering, the complete suspension should therefore be inspected rather than automatically assuming that the rear stabilizer links are responsible.
